《开源商业化三维游戏引擎大揭秘》为中文读者深入、完整掌握游戏引擎C++、Python核心内容提供了“先天下之阅而阅”的揭秘地图。全书图文并茂、实例丰富,配书光盘中有80多段演示效果视频,为Windows、Linux、Mac操作系统中的C++、Python游戏引擎掘金者提供了价值无穷的资源。
评分
评分
评分
评分
这本书的潜在读者群体一定非常广泛,从初涉游戏开发的在校学生到资深的独立开发者,甚至包括那些希望了解技术趋势的企业决策者。因此,我非常期待作者在叙事风格上能做到游刃有余,既能满足技术极客对深度钻研的渴望,又不至于让非专业人士感到气馁。想象一下,作者能否用类比的手法,把复杂的内存管理和资源流式加载机制,比喻成一个高效运转的工厂物流系统?这种将抽象概念具象化的能力,是区分优秀技术作家和平庸技术作者的关键。此外,我强烈建议书中加入一些交互式的学习材料或在线资源链接。比如,对于某个关键算法的伪代码讲解之后,如果能提供一个Github仓库链接,让读者可以下载和运行一个最小化的实现版本,那么这本书的学习效果将是几何级增长的。毕竟,对于游戏引擎这种高度实践性的领域,纸面上的知识终究是有限的,动手实践才是王道。
评分我对这本书的期待,更多是集中在“开源商业化”这个关键词上。在如今这个软件生态快速迭代的时代,开源的力量不容小觑,但如何将技术热情转化为可持续的商业价值,一直是许多技术团队面临的难题。这本书如果能深入剖析几个成功的开源引擎(或许是类似Godot或者Unreal的社区驱动模式)的商业变现路径,那对我来说简直是无价之宝。我想看到的不是空泛的理论,而是具体的商业模式案例,比如:它们是如何通过提供企业级服务、定制化开发、或者生态系统建设来获取收入的?社区贡献者和核心开发者之间的利益平衡又是如何处理的?特别是对于那些希望基于开源技术创业的团队,书中是否能提供一份详尽的路线图,指导他们如何规避知识产权的陷阱,同时又能最大化社区价值?如果能对当前市场上主流的几种开源许可协议(如MIT, GPL, Apache等)在商业游戏引擎领域的适用性和风险点做个详细的对比分析,那就更好了。我对技术细节的兴趣,很大程度上是为了理解这些商业决策背后的技术支撑和限制。
评分读完书名后,我立刻在脑海中构建了一个关于全书结构的画面:前三分之一应该是基础理论构建,可能是对现代图形学基础知识的快速回顾,比如矩阵变换、几何体表示等等,但愿不会过于冗长。中间的核心部分,我猜会是深入解构不同引擎架构的对比分析,例如,一个基于固定功能管线(Fixed-Function Pipeline)的引擎和一个基于可编程管线(Programmable Pipeline,即Shader为主)的引擎在设计哲学上的根本差异。我非常希望看到作者能对“数据导向设计”(Data-Oriented Design, DOD)在现代高性能引擎中的应用进行专门的探讨,因为在追求极致性能的今天,DOD似乎是绕不开的话题。最后一部分,或许会涉及到引擎的工具链、编辑器设计,以及如何优化资源导入和打包流程。如果书中能穿插一些实战中的“坑”与“经验谈”,比如某个优化技巧如何显著提升帧率,或者某个渲染特性在不同硬件上的兼容性问题,那这本书的实用价值就会大大提升。我总觉得,技术书籍的价值,往往体现在那些“不应该发生但却发生了”的边缘案例处理上。
评分这本书的封面设计真是独具匠心,那种深邃的蓝色调配上闪烁着科技感的线条,一下子就把我的注意力牢牢抓住了。我本来对“三维游戏引擎”这个概念有点望而生畏,总觉得是那种晦涩难懂的技术手册,但看到这个书名,尤其是“大揭秘”三个字,立刻激发了我强烈的求知欲。我特别期待作者能用一种非常平易近人的方式,把那些复杂的底层逻辑给掰开揉碎了讲清楚。比如,我很想知道一个优秀的三维引擎是如何处理光影渲染的?它背后那些复杂的数学公式是如何转化为我们肉眼可见的逼真画面的?如果能结合一些业界知名的开源引擎案例来分析,那就更棒了。我设想书中应该会有一章专门讲解如何从零开始搭建一个简易的渲染管线,哪怕只是概念上的演示,也足以让我对这个领域有更宏观的认识。这种从宏观到微观,层层递进的讲解方式,才是一个真正好的技术科普读物应该具备的素质。我希望这本书能让我明白,那些看似魔幻的游戏画面背后,其实是严谨的科学和巧妙的工程学设计。
评分我个人关注游戏引擎的“易用性”和“扩展性”往往高于纯粹的性能指标。一个功能再强大的引擎,如果其API设计得晦涩难懂,或者二次开发需要修改大量的核心代码,那么它的生命力必然会受到限制。所以,我热切期盼本书能对开源引擎的架构设计哲学进行一番深入探讨:他们是如何在“开箱即用”的便利性和“高度可定制”的自由度之间找到平衡点的?例如,如何设计一个灵活的组件化系统(ECS或类似结构),使得新的功能模块可以不侵入核心代码就能被集成?我尤其关注脚本系统与底层C++代码的交互效率和安全性。如果书中能分析不同引擎在设计其脚本层(如Lua、Python或自研脚本)时所做的权衡,比如热重载的实现难度、调试工具的支持程度,那将极大地帮助我评估一个引擎的长期维护成本和开发效率。这本书如果能解答这些关于“工程美学”的问题,而非仅仅是堆砌技术名词,那它无疑会成为一本行业内的经典参考书。
评分 评分 评分 评分 评分本站所有内容均为互联网搜索引擎提供的公开搜索信息,本站不存储任何数据与内容,任何内容与数据均与本站无关,如有需要请联系相关搜索引擎包括但不限于百度,google,bing,sogou 等
© 2026 qciss.net All Rights Reserved. 小哈图书下载中心 版权所有